
The weather was frightful Dec. 6, but that didn’t deter a steady stream of pets – and they owners – from coming to Sampson G. Smith School for pictures with “Santa Paws.”
The event is an annual fundraiser for Second Chance for Animals, the group which funds the Franklin Township Animal Shelter.
SCFA president Bob Pezzano said there was a steady stream of customers during the day.
After pictures are taken, pet parents can purchase prints in a variety of formats.
All proceeds go to SCFA.
The fundraiser continues Dec. 13 and 20, from 10:30 a.m. to 3 p.m.
